Output 8b2b581c31d3560d51f89af7b0ecb1744c46a83fe3a0626921db315984605064:3

value
30539759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 023e791b9b528f7dccfe1d7827d58f98e2e885c5 OP_EQUAL
address
31tt7dfTChrePQrd3b8JDtZe3amGDb1yBX
transaction
8b2b581c31d3560d51f89af7b0ecb1744c46a83fe3a0626921db315984605064
spent
true